Top 5 Cooking Games Performance in Australia: Q1 2025
Discover the performance trends of top cooking games on a unified platform in Australia during Q1 2025, with insights from Sensor Tower.
In the first quarter of 2025, the Australian market saw varying performance trends among the top cooking games on a unified platform. Let's delve into the specifics of these popular apps.
Good Coffee, Great Coffee, published by TAPBLAZE, experienced a notable decrease in weekly downloads, starting at around 42K and dropping to 9.4K by the end of March. The game's weekly revenue followed a similar downward trajectory, beginning at approximately $3.5K and declining to $917. However, the active users peaked at 53.2K in early March before falling to 10.7K.
Pizza Ready! by Supercent, Inc. maintained a relatively stable revenue, peaking at $1.8K in late March. Weekly downloads showed a slight recovery from a mid-quarter dip, rising to about 9.7K. Active users remained consistent, hovering around 35K to 41K.
Gossip Harbor®: Merge & Story from Microfun Limited boasted strong performance with weekly revenue peaking at $209.9K in late March. Downloads remained steady, averaging around 7K to 8K. The app also enjoyed a robust active user base, increasing from 139K to 161K throughout the quarter.
Good Pizza, Great Pizza, another title by TAPBLAZE, showed fluctuations in weekly revenue, ending the quarter at $2.3K. Downloads saw a mid-quarter increase, reaching 7.5K, while active users varied between 7K and 12K.
Lastly, Jelly Master: Mukbang ASMR by Hieu Nguyen Trung reported no revenue but experienced a rise in downloads from 4.7K to 7K. Active users peaked at 16.4K before dropping to 6.7K by quarter's end.
